Will technology take over the world ?

Technology has undoubtedly made remarkable progress in the past few decades, with advancements in fields like artificial intelligence, robotics, biotechnology, and quantum computing. It has changed the way we live, work, and communicate. From self-driving cars to voice-activated assistants, technology has made our lives easier and more convenient. However, along with its benefits, many fear that technology may pose a threat to humanity. The concept of technology taking over the world has been a popular theme in science fiction for years, but is there any truth to it?


The answer is that while there are certainly risks associated with technological advancements, the idea of technology taking over the world is highly unlikely. One of the main reasons for this is that technology is created and controlled by humans. While machines and algorithms are becoming more sophisticated, they are still bound by the limitations of their programming. In other words, machines can only do what they are programmed to do. They lack the ability to think, feel, and act on their own without human intervention.

Moreover, the development of technology is heavily regulated. Governments and international organizations have put in place strict laws and regulations to ensure that technological advancements are made responsibly and ethically. For example, the European Union's General Data Protection Regulation (GDPR) requires companies to obtain explicit consent from individuals before collecting their data. Similarly, the United Nations Convention on Certain Conventional Weapons (CCW) restricts the use of autonomous weapons in warfare. These regulations ensure that technology is used for the benefit of humanity, rather than being used to harm or control it.

Furthermore, technology is a tool, not an end in itself. While it is true that technology can be used for malicious purposes, it is also true that it has been used to solve some of the world's most pressing problems. For instance, biotechnology has revolutionized healthcare, making it possible to diagnose and treat diseases that were once considered incurable. AI has the potential to improve our understanding of complex systems, from climate change to human behavior. It has also opened up new possibilities in fields like transportation, agriculture, and energy.





Lastly, it is worth noting that technology is not a monolithic entity. There are countless different technologies, each with its own strengths and weaknesses. While some technologies may pose risks, others may offer significant benefits. For instance, the development of renewable energy technologies has the potential to reduce our dependence on fossil fuels and mitigate the effects of climate change. Similarly, blockchain technology has the potential to create more secure and transparent systems of governance and commerce.

In conclusion, the idea of technology taking over the world is an intriguing concept, but it is highly unlikely to become a reality. While there are certainly risks associated with technological advancements, they are far outweighed by the benefits that technology brings to our lives. As long as we continue to use technology responsibly and ethically, there is no reason to fear that it will become our master rather than our servant. The key is to ensure that technology is developed and used for the benefit of all humanity, rather than being controlled by a select few.
